AI Compliance NLWeb
A conversational AI-compliance workbench. An NLWeb-style layer over the world's AI rules and standards, exposed two ways over one retrieval + answer core: /ask for people (structured JSON) and /mcp for agents (MCP tools). Ask natural-language questions about the EU AI Act, ISO/IEC 42001, the NIST AI RMF, GDPR, US executive orders, and national frameworks — and get grounded, cited answers. RAG-only and accuracy-first: every claim cites [framework §section, p.N], and when the corpus can't support an answer, it says so rather than guessing.

What it does
Ask questions like:
- "How do I implement ISO 42001?"
- "Compare US vs EU AI policy."
- "What records must I keep under the EU AI Act for a high-risk system?"
- "What does GDPR say about automated decision-making for AI?"
…and get an answer grounded in the actual regulatory text, with a collapsible Sources list (document · section · page · link), a confidence signal, a live token-usage readout, and token-by-token streaming. Every claim is cited; if the corpus doesn't support an answer, it says so.

- One core, two contracts.
/askreturns structured JSON (Schema.orgItemList)
for humans/UI; /mcp (JSON-RPC, MCP) exposes the same retrieval + answer core as tools for agents. Both accept the same payload; query is the only required field. A mode of list / summarize / generate controls whether the LLM runs at all (list is retrieval-only — no model call).
- Accuracy first. Structure-aware chunking (citations name the article/clause),
hybrid dense + sparse retrieval with RRF fusion, a cross-encoder reranker, doc-hint steering (naming a framework scopes retrieval to it), and citation-enforced generation.
- Dual runtime profile.
RUNTIME_PROFILE=localruns entirely on Docker (Qdrant +
Ollama qwen3:14b + mxbai-embed-large, 1024-d); RUNTIME_PROFILE=azure uses Azure OpenAI (gpt-4.1 + text-embedding-3-small, 1536-d) with Azure AI Search, provisioned by Bicep. Each profile is a matched {store, embedder, answer-model} triple.

The corpus
48 open-access documents · 32 frameworks, across five tiers — 100% open-access, no paywalled content:
| Tier | Focus | Docs | |---|---|---:| | Global / International standards | ISO/IEC AI standards (open summaries), OECD, UNESCO, G7, Council of Europe | 8 | | EU / UK / National frameworks | EU AI Act & digital rulebook, GDPR, UK, Canada (AIDA), Singapore, Brazil, China | 16 | | US Federal | NIST AI RMF family, OMB memos, 2025 executive orders, NIST CSF / SP 800-53, FedRAMP | 13 | | US State | Colorado, Texas, Utah, California, New York City, Illinois | 8 | | Sector / Cloud | Cloud Security Alliance, Microsoft, Google | 3 |
A versioned manifest ([manifest/corpus.yaml](manifest/corpus.yaml)) is the source of truth; [scripts/fetch_corpus.py](scripts/fetch_corpus.py) pulls the open-access texts. ISO/IEC standards (which are copyrighted) are represented by open, non-normative authored summaries in [manifest/summaries/](manifest/summaries/) — the corpus is fully reproducible from open sources, with no paywalled content committed.
